Joe Biden hints at 2024 presidential run in interview with Al Roker.

TL;DR Summary
President Biden told Al Roker in an interview that he plans on running for re-election in 2024, but is not yet prepared to announce it. Biden's advanced age and questions about his mental acuity have led to doubts among fellow Democrats. If he were to back out, potential contenders for the Democratic nomination include Vice President Kamala Harris, California Gov. Gavin Newsom, and Transportation Secretary Pete Buttigieg. Former President Donald Trump is the front-runner for the 2024 GOP nomination, with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is expected to launch his candidacy next month.
